Output 7591cb2ec6a5c28022b177fd3427c3e37b85837edc76b523e1b00b88fc4d74a2: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8622e6c6da7dde64a44f1dc32258562e302cf854 OP_EQUALVERIFY OP_CHECKSIG
address
1DEFMhigsaDJDvNzSWdAXvwodLYfkFqNSC
transaction
7591cb2ec6a5c28022b177fd3427c3e37b85837edc76b523e1b00b88fc4d74a2
confirmations
621744
spent
true